15khz Amiga compatible monitor

Morning all,

Just decided on a whim to connect my A1200 to a spare 2015 LCD monitor.
It is an Acer G226HQL and isn’t specifically listed on here http://15khz.wikidot.com/
Used a passive Amiga 23pin to VGA adapter.

Image is pin sharp but locked in 16:9 and has very faint vertical banding. Interlace modes still flicker.
Lo Res games also look great with smooth scrolling, although still in 16:9.
